The paper explores the development of joint action capabilities in infants, emphasizing its significance for social participation. It highlights a gap in cognitive and neuronal sciences regarding when this ability emerges in young children, particularly in cooperative settings with adults or peers. By examining existing studies, the research aims to shed light on this crucial aspect of human nature and its implications for understanding early childhood development.
